Designing a Shopify website isn't just about picking the right theme; it's about crafting an experience that enchants your audience.
First, focus on clear and concise messaging. Compose compelling content that highlights your products' unique benefits. Your website should be visually engaging, with high-quality images and a clean, intuitive design.
Consider these essentials:
* **Mobile Optimization:** Ensure your site looks great and functions smoothly on all devices.
* **Fast Loading Speeds:** No one likes a slow website. Improve your images and code for optimal performance.
* **Intuitive Navigation:** Make it easy for visitors to find what they're looking for with a clear navigation bar.

Crafting a Conversion-Focused Shopify Store
Launching a successful Shopify store goes beyond simply showcasing your products. To truly thrive, you need to optimize your store with conversion in mind. This means creating an engaging user experience that guides customers towards making a purchase.
- Leverage high-quality product images and compelling text to showcase your offerings in the best possible light.
- Optimize the checkout process to minimize cart abandonment and boost conversion rates.
- Implement clear and concise call-to-actions that encourage customers to take the next step.
A/B testing is crucial for discovering what resonates with your audience and optimizing your store's performance. By prioritizing on these key elements, you can build a Shopify store that converts visitors into loyal customers.
Elevate Your Shopify Store with Theme Customization
Your Shopify theme is the face of your online store, and customizing it allows you to truly express your brand's unique personality. With a wide array of tools and options available, you can mold your store's design to effortlessly match your vision.
Immerse into the world of Shopify theme customization and unlock the potential to create an online experience that is both mesmerizing and efficient. From tweaking color palettes and fonts to integrating custom sections and elements, the possibilities are truly endless.
Start your journey by investigating the built-in customization options within your chosen theme. Many Shopify themes offer a user-friendly interface that allows you to make simple changes without requiring any coding knowledge. For more complex modifications, consider working with a Shopify expert or developer who can help you achieve your design goals.
